    DPM-based method for tracking maneuvering targets in wireless sensor networks by LIN Jin-zhao1, LI Guo-jun2, ZHOU Xiao-na2, ZHOU Dao-jun 2, JIANG Yong 2

    Published 2010-01-01
    “…Focused on energy efficiency issues under tracking targets within WSN,a new dynamic power management(DPM) method for tracking distributed targets was proposed combining with the network energy consumption model and wake-up mechanism.With precedent location information of maneuvering target,the algorithm involved both cancelling noise by wavelet filter and predicting target state by autoregressive transformation is introduced to awaken wireless sensor nodes so that their sleep time is prolonged and energy consumption is reduced.According to the current location of maneuvering target,related nodes in an appointed cluster of WSN constitute a distributed dynamic tracking unit,and the cluster head is responsible for collecting the measurement information from the nodes in the tracking unit.A locating algorithm based on the relative posi-tion of two circulars formed on the bases of measurement information is adopted to simplify the process of locatiny and tracking target.Simulation results show that the DPM-based method can reduce the nodes’ energy consumption,meet the locating and tracking accuracy,and can be applied to locate and track the maneuvering targets on the earth surface.…”
